The lower with the tinder fungus comprises of a heavy quantity of tubes or skin pores that are lotion or pale brown in colour, and about 0.3 mm across.

The pores replace the function of gills generally in most mushrooms, and present increase on the name polypore when it comes down to group fungi and bolete fungi that possess them. A brand new covering of pipes or pores try produced annually, and it’s really because of these that the spores tend to be circulated in-may and June every single year. The spores tend to be microscopic in dimensions and made in prodigious volumes – one learn recorded 800 million released in one hour! The spores include distributed by the wind and certainly will began raising once they land on lifeless material, such as the stumps from busted branches or stem scars on a tree.

The woody fungal system (or sporocarp since it is technically recognized) that grows out from the dead material will be the fruiting human anatomy with the kinds – the main part of the fungi may be the community of filaments or hyphae that build within the tree’s wooden it self.

Tinder fungus contributes towards the powerful and modifying character of forests through their role in mortality of woods. The death of a forest helps write spaces within the forest, thereby letting extra light-demanding species of forest and shrub becoming founded. Waiting lifeless trees (also called snags) like birch provide nesting websites for a variety of species of wild birds, consequently they are additionally an important foods source for numerous species of dead-wood centered invertebrates.

As a saprotrophic species, the tinder fungi plays a crucial role in extracting the cellulose and lignin stored in a tree’s lumber, deciding to make asiandate Darmowa aplikacja the nutrients it includes designed for additional varieties inside forest ecosystem. This recycling cleanup furthermore relates to the tinder fungus it self, that’s decomposed to some extent by another fungus (Amblyosporium botrytis). Another nine types of fungi have been tape-recorded raising on tinder fungus, like cobweb mould (Hypomyces rosellus).

Numerous beetles tend to be directly related to tinder fungus, like the black tinder fungi beetle (Bolitophagus reticulatus), whoever larvae reside within the fruiting system, in addition to forked fungus beetle (Bolitotherus cornutus), the larvae and adults that both feed on the fungus – the adults also assist to distribute the fungal spores. Two uncommon Red facts Book-listed beetles (Cis dentatus and Rhopalodontus perforatus) that occur in connection using the black colored tinder fungi beetle have now been taped in Glen Affric. Another variety that lives in association making use of black colored tinder fungi beetle are a mite (Boletoglyphus boletophagi). The mite feeds inside the tubules or skin pores with the tinder fungi and its particular nymphs or larvae include phoretic in the beetle, and therefore they affix themselves to the sex beetle and use it for transfer to brand-new host fungi. Another beetle from the fungi was Triplax russica , as well as the grownups within this varieties, that has been recorded on Dundreggan, tend to be observed seated throughout the higher area of the fruiting systems. One learn in Norway identified 35 various species of beetles as staying in the sporocarps with the tinder fungus.

The larvae of several moth varieties overwinter in class fungi in Scotland, at the very least those types of (Archinemapogon yildizae) utilises tinder fungus for this purpose.

The tinder fungus has also have a lengthy relationship with human beings, and both their typical and medical brands mirror the efficiency as an excellent supply of tinder for beginning fireplaces. One’s body on the ‘Iceman’ discover preserved in a glacier when you look at the Alps in 1991, and dating back to to over 5,000 in years past, ended up being followed by a pouch that contain flint and a bit of dehydrated tinder fungus, indicating this starred an important role after that in people’s using flames.

Tinder fungus can be the foundation of amadou, a material utilised by anglers to draw out moisture from flies they normally use as lure. The fungus has additionally always been known to bring vital healing properties, plus 400 BC Hippocrates referred to it used as an anti-inflammatory. Current studies have learned that it has stronger anti-viral and anti-bacterial residential properties, therefore verifying its age-old need.
